#693de1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#693de1 is composed of 41.2% red, 23.9% green and 88.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.3% cyan, 72.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 256.1 degrees, a saturation of 73.2% and a lightness of 56.1%. #693de1 color hex could be obtained by blending #d27aff with #0000c3.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

Shades and Tints of #693de1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04020a is the darkest color, while #f9f8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#693de1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d8b93 is the less saturated color, while #5d23fb is the most saturated one.
